Why Live in Washington

Washington, located just south of downtown Visalia, is a neighborhood known for its walkability and convenient access to local amenities. Residents enjoy the ease of walking to downtown shops and restaurants without the influx of out-of-town visitors. The neighborhood features a mix of ranch-style bungalows and Tudor revival homes, many with spacious backyards, private pools, and shaded driveways. The area is family-friendly, with children walking to nearby schools such as Washington Elementary and the highly rated Mt. Whitney High School. Jefferson Park and Seven Oaks Park provide recreational options, including sports fields, playgrounds, and a dog park. The ImagineU Children’s Museum and Regal Cinema offer additional entertainment. Dining options are plentiful, with Brewbakers Brewing Company, The Cellar Door, and Crawdaddy’s providing diverse culinary experiences. Shopping is convenient with stores like The Rose Boutique and The Odd Shop on Court Street, and Mary’s Vinyard Shopping Center nearby. The Visalia Transit bus system and proximity to Highway 99 make commuting easy. With a median age of 30 and a high rental population, Washington is a vibrant and active community.
